Parents of feverish babies will be glad to hear that they can abandon
uncomfortable rectal thermometers in favour of a 鈥渄ummy thermometer鈥 that
soothes sick children at the same time as taking an accurate temperature
reading. The device developed by Florida-based Stridden uses a standard
electronic thermometer surrounded by a removable silicone nipple. Paediatricians
have welcomed the thermometer, but parents are warned that it gives readings 0.3
掳C lower than rectal temperatures, which remain the best indicator of
fever.
